Output de30bc6d9497f64b443a221dfaab807ae821235a0f16bcfae1cc06be29667a95:0

value
38968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908da06b89caa42c42dd735545ce37c30a74ec9a OP_EQUAL
address
3EsLtZNFXqKuxaoivSPJtmSGjkv1HBVEwU
transaction
de30bc6d9497f64b443a221dfaab807ae821235a0f16bcfae1cc06be29667a95